Default I'm not sure if you meant it that way, but a car getting totaled has nothing to do with

whether it drives or not. It's simply an equation the insurance company applies to determine whether the cost of repairs would exceed a given percentage of their estimate of the car's value.

Cars are expensive to repair, and parts and labor add up very quickly. What will you need to replace? Bumper, hood, body panels, lights, radiator, suspension, ...? Was there damage to the frame? Once you see an itemized list with costs you'll probably do a double take.
